2BR Canal-front Condo on Padre Island - 5 mins to Whitecap Beach
Come and relax at this peaceful, Padre Island canal-front property that faces the water. This coastal property has 2 pools (indoor heated and outdoor), a fishing station, boat slips, and more. Centrally-located, near restaurants, coffee shops, bars, and stores. Just a five-min drive to Whitecap Beach (20min to Port A). Kitchenware, cable, wi-fi, washer, dryer and beach towels are all included in this 2BR, 1.5 bath charming condo.

Pics look great, but don't show all about this property.
The great: First off, the beds were VERY comfy! Rooms were decorated nicely!Glad to have some stocked snacks in the kitchen!Canal is right next to the building! Should have tried fishing it.The garage has a hose to rinse off beach salt and sand off vehicle.The host was very helpful and super responsive. The meh: this was built in 1974, so it's 50 years old, it feels that old. It could use some TLC to make easier to use. The 2 bedrooms are right next to each other with a completely stuck pocket door between. Zero privacy. The garage is open to any passerby, along with the 27 other cars in it, is downstairs, has no door to secure vehicle and is very short ceiling, antenna scraped the whole way in and out.The double front door into the apt/condo is only secured with a pin at the top, is missing the one at the bottom, this could easily push open. Bathrooms are very small, super small sink area. The shower fixture comes out of the wall, is not secure or sanitary, IMHO.The kitchen was ok, but had fruit flies coming out of one side of the sink. Glad for the stacked W/D laundry, but it is crazy loud, don't plan on starting a load and going to bed like we did. Tile floors were quite uneven and stubbed toes. The light switches were hard to find in some rooms. Not where you expect them.And lastly, the trim work and paint had much to be desired, very old and worn. You can see some attached pics. Sorry to be so direct in this review, but I wish I knew these things before.
